In a meeting with Sri Lankan President Mahinda Rajapaksa, Ayatollah Khamenei referred to Sri Lanka’s positive measures to support the Palestinian nation and expressed appreciation for the Sri Lankan government’s fair treatment of its Muslim residents.
“Fortunately, the Sri Lankan government is treating Muslims with courtesy. We appreciate this approach,” Ayatollah Khamenei said.
The Supreme Leader also called for the expansion of relations between the two countries.
Rajapaksa said that Iran and Sri Lanka have historic and friendly relations, adding that the two countries have implemented many joint projects.
Commenting on the terrorism problem in Sri Lanka, he said, “The terrorists were seeking to divide the country into two parts, but we managed to clear them from the eastern areas, and now we are taking great steps for the country’s development.”
He pointed out that Sri Lanka has established a committee tasked with supporting the Palestinian nation.
“We condemn the Zionists’ acts of aggression and favor the establishment of an independent Palestinian state,” the Sri Lankan president added.
